The Department for Planning and Infrastructure entered a new era on 1 July 2003 with the final implementation of the Machinery of Government recommendations and the structural improvements announced by the Director General in the previous year:

  • The Land Administration Services team, which manages the Crown land in Western Australia, joined Land Asset Management to form part of Commercial and Asset Services.
  • The Department of Fisheries was assigned maritime safety (on the sea) with a corresponding movement of resources and is accountable for service delivery to the Minister for Planning and Infrastructure.
Transperth, School Buses and Public Transport Infrastructure joined the Public Transport Authority. In 2003-04, the Department for Planning and Infrastructure was structured into six divisions:
  • Strategic Policy and Evaluation - responsible for portfolio coordination; sustainability strategy implementation; transport policy; strategic program delivery; and revitalisation strategies.
  • Integrated Planning - delivers land use policy and planning; transport policy and planning; environmental planning; and infrastructure and development coordination on behalf of the Western Australian Planning Commission and other clients.
  • Commercial and Asset Services - manages $1.6 billion of assets including Crown and reserved lands; natural and built infrastructure; parks; gas pipelines; boat harbours; jetties and navigational aids; and provides commercial services for the rest of the Department.
  • Regulatory and Regional Services - manages all licensing; subsidy policy and administration; vehicle, rail and marine safety regulation; taxi and omnibus regulation; revenue collection; and regional coordination throughout the state.
  • Statutory Planning - on behalf of the Western Australian Planning Commission investigates, assesses and determines subdivision and development proposals, local government and region schemes and amendments, and various structure plans; is responsible for statutory policy development, legislative and regulatory reform and planning systems improvement; and provides administrative support.
  • Corporate Services - provides internal systems, services and resources to support departmental operations, and supports greater use of shared services across agencies.
